Climate Changes Through Earth’s History

As continents shifted, the global climate varied as well. Geological data can also reveal that there were changes in temperature, ice cover, and carbon dioxide concentrations throughout the history of our planet.
Temperature: The Earth has had periods in the past that were really cold and other times that were really hot, but the oceans never completely froze, nor did they ever boil away.

Ice Cover: The amount of ice covering the planet has increased and decreased throughout history.

Carbon Dioxide: The concentration of carbon dioxide in Earth’s atmosphere has cycled between low levels and high levels.
